Vince Cunanan’s clutch performance carries Lyceum past San Beda in NCAA thriller


By: Bjorn Del B. Deade

Vincent Cunanan delivered a stunning performance in the clutch, propelling Lyceum of the Philippines University to a dramatic 64-62 victory over San Beda University in the NCAA Season 100 Seniors’ Basketball Tournament at the Filoil EcoOil Centre on Tuesday.

With less than 50 seconds remaining, Cunanan hit a long, buzzer-beating three-pointer to steal the lead for the Pirates, followed by another critical three-pointer just 8.6 seconds before the final buzzer, securing the win for the Pirates, who rose to 6-5 to the fourth-running Letran Knights.

San Beda had a chance to respond but failed to capitalize after Bryan Sajonia lost the ball during a fast break, sealing the Red Lions’ defeat.

“Patay na yung shot clock. E nakita ako ni (John) Barba and libre ako. Kahit nagmimintis ako sa una, e open ako, tinira ko na talaga. Ngayon pasok naman, sa awa ng diyos nakapasok,” said Cunanan, who finished with 11 points, all scored in the crucial moments of the game.

“Kilala naman yung team namin na hindi talaga naggigive up hanggang sa final buzzer. Kaya laban lang talaga kahit na lamang, laban pa rin kami. After the Pirates tied the match at 12-all with a bank shot from Montaño, San Beda went on an 11-0 run, fueled by Sajonia’s six points, to take a 23-12 lead at the end of the first quarter.

Despite San Beda’s eight-point advantage with five minutes left in the second quarter (28-20), Cunanan ignited a 6-0 run with a fast-break layup, narrowing the Red Lions’ lead to just two points at 26-28.

The Red Lions maintained their lead as Payosing finished strong with a drive, and Bismark Lina added a hook shot over Abiles, pushing the score to 32-28 until Cunanan’s three-point play kept the Pirates within striking distance at halftime, trailing 32-31.

The third quarter was a low-scoring affair, with San Beda’s largest lead being five points after a three-point play from Jhonel Puno made it 40-35.

However, the relentless Pirates managed to tie the game at 44-all by the end of the third, courtesy of Montaño’s timely three-pointer.

In the final period, San Beda sought to regain momentum through Estacio’s crucial baskets but could not stop Cunanan’s hot shooting.

Gyle Montaño led LPU with 12 points on 55.6-percent shooting, while John Bravo contributed nine points and seven rebounds.

The Pirates will next face Arellano University on Saturday, October 19, at 11 a.m.

On the other side, Bismark Lina paced San Beda with 12 points and eight rebounds, while Yukien Andrada added 11 points on a poor 28.6-percent shooting.

Puno also contributed 10 points and five rebounds.

The Red Lions dropped to a 7-4 record and will look to bounce back against the University of Perpetual Help System DALTA on Friday, October 18, at 12 p.m.

The Scores

Lyceum 64 – Montaño 12, Cunanan 11, Bravo 9, Daileg 7, Villegas 6, Aviles 5, Barba 4, Peñafiel 4, Panelo 2, Versoza 2, Gordon 2, Moralejo 0, Pallingayan 0.

San Beda 62 – Lina 12, Andrada 11, Puno 10, Sajonia 8, Estacio 8, Payosing 6, Tagle 5, Songcuya 2, Gonzales 0, Celzo 0, RC Calimag 0, Royo 0.
